Beyond the silver screen, Manisha Koirala’s lifestyle is a testament to resilience, holistic healing, and conscious living. After surviving stage IV ovarian cancer, diagnosed in 2012, her approach to life underwent a radical transformation. : Rather than chasing volume, Koirala selectively chooses

Manisha practices yoga, meditation, and embraces an organic, healthy diet to maintain her physical and mental well-being. She often shares snippets of her wellness routines on social media.

Directed by Vidhu Vinod Chopra, this patriotic romance became a milestone in Indian cinema. Koirala’s portrayal of Rajeshwari Pathak against the backdrop of the Indian independence movement earned her widespread praise, showcasing her capacity to lead high-stakes, emotionally demanding narratives.
